A sober, healing and vegan wellbeing space

Set within the festival site at Bentley Estate, the Om & Bass area will offer a quieter and more restorative dimension to the weekend. Alongside the sound systems, woodland arenas, camping and culture of the festival, this space creates room for people to breathe, stretch, ground themselves and reconnect. Om & Bass events are built around expert-led wellbeing sessions, inclusive participation and the idea that healing spaces should feel accessible, safe and full of life rather than overly formal or performative. 

Free workshops across the weekend

Across the weekend, Om & Bass area will be offering free workshops in:

 

  • yoga

  • mindfulness

  • meditation

  • relaxation

  • sound baths

  • Ice Baths

  • saunas

  • shamanic practices

  • ceremonies

  • martial arts

  • tai chi

  • qi gong

This sits very naturally with the way Om & Bass presents its wider programme, which regularly includes yoga, meditation, martial arts, sound healing, empowerment, ceremonies and movement-based practices led by experienced facilitators. Their event pages also highlight dance, breathwork, kirtan, sound journeys and workshops designed to support both energy and calm across a full festival day. 

Bookable specialist sessions

Alongside the free programme, there will also be a small number of additional paid workshops, including:

 

  • Sacred Blue Lotus Ceremony

  • Healing Cacao Ceremony

  • Ice Bath with Breathwork

 

These specialist workshops can be booked in advance to avoid disappointment.

FAQ

What is Om & Bass?

Om & Bass a music and wellness festival brand built around inclusivity, wellbeing, fun and community. It was founded as a wellness-and-music gathering and now runs events in multiple locations. 

 

Is the Om & Bass area part of One Love / One Sun?

Yes. Om & Bass forms part of the wider One Love / One Sun festival environment as a dedicated holistic and wellbeing area.

 

Do I need to book workshops?

Many workshops will be free and open as part of the wider Om & Bass space. Some specialist sessions, including the Sacred Blue Lotus Ceremony, Healing Cacao Ceremony and Ice Bath with Breathwork, will be bookable in advance.

 

Is it only for experienced people?

No. Om & Bass publicly positions itself as accessible, inclusive and down to earth, with a strong emphasis on welcoming different people and different experience levels. 

 

Is the space vegan and sober?

Yes — this area is being presented within the festival as a sober, healing and vegan wellbeing space.
